Brief summary
This study aims to investigate the incidence of venous thromboembolism in people who are diagnosed with atopic dermatitis.
Detailed description
The aim of this study is to examine whether venous thromboembolism is higher in people with atopic dermatitis compared and those without and to explore the risk in particular subgroups of people with AD such as those with higher body mass index or using oestrogen containing contraceptives. Such insights will be valuable for clinicians in advising patients with atopic dermatitis regarding venous thromboembolism prevention and detection and when selecting atopic dermatitis treatments.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* All eligible adult people (aged ≥ 18) registered with GP practices contributing data to OPCRD between January 1, 2010 and January 1, 2020, were eligible for inclusion in the study.
Exclusion criteria
* People with less than 5 years potential follow up. People with atopic dermatitis that was not active atopic dermatitis during the study period. People without atopic dermatitis but diagnosed with other skin conditions.

Participant flow
Participants by arm
| Arm | Count |
|---|---|
| Cases All adults with an episode of active atopic dermatitis at any point between 1st Jan 2010 to 1st Jan 2015 will be included for analysis.
Exposure of venous thromboembolism: Composite of pulmonary embolism and deep vein thrombosis | 150,975 |
| Controls Adults without atopic dermatitis or other skin conditions matched to cases by age, gender, and duration of practice registration.
Exposure of venous thromboembolism: Composite of pulmonary embolism and deep vein thrombosis | 603,770 |
| Total | 754,745 |

Outcome results
Number of Participants With Diagnosis of Venous Thromboembolism After the Start of Follow-up for Each Person.
To describe the risk of venous thromboembolism (composite of pulmonary embolism and deep vein thrombosis) in people with active AD compared to a matched control population.
Time frame: 10 years from index date
| Arm | Measure | Value (COUNT_OF_PARTICIPANTS) |
|---|---|---|
| Cases | Number of Participants With Diagnosis of Venous Thromboembolism After the Start of Follow-up for Each Person. | 2576 Participants |
| Controls | Number of Participants With Diagnosis of Venous Thromboembolism After the Start of Follow-up for Each Person. | 7563 Participants |
